Let’s start off with the iconic fried chicken. While yes, it’s a very popular and many would say the tastiness chicken out there, it is very high in calories and is a common food related to obesity and overweight gain. The frying process also often involves oils that are high in saturated and trans fats, which raise cholesterol levels and increase the risk of heart disease. Fried chicken because of its calorie count, and bad high trans fats is and will be not considered the best chicken and is eliminated.

The chicken that takes the win in this race is grilled chicken. Grilled chicken is a lean protein high in protein and better yet includes low saturated fat and calories, making it a good choice for a balanced diet and weight management and better yet a great meal, great for staying fit and full for the long term. Grilled chicken is also very easy and simple to prepare, making it easily one of the cheapest and most assessable chicken out there.
